  • Hi, All -

    I have always gotten four different vouchers for four different restaurants - exchanging 2.50 each into 10 each.

    Do the vouchers always come in 10 denominations? Or if I put in that I want 10 to Cafe Rouge are they going to send me one (useless) voucher for 40 at Cafe Rouge?

    Trying to change a load before it goes down to 3x tomorrow.

    Thanks!

    They always send restaurant vouchers out in multiples of £10, but did you know that these vouchers are generic anyway and can not only be used in any of the restaurants on offer but in fact on any deal that is not buy in full.

    I ordered £80 worth of so-called "Pizza Express" voucher but have so far used £30 of them in Cafe Rouge and a further £20 in the Beatles Story museum. You're not restricted if the vouchers you are buying say something like "£2.50 in CC vouchers buys you £10 in tokens".

    Yes, all three of the rewards mentioned above are interchangeable as they are all Non - "Buy in full" tokens. But although I have never bought Goldsmiths vouchers, I do believe that they tend to send their vouchers out in higher denominations, not just £10 as with the restaurant and day out vouchers. So you may end up with 7 x £10 "Day out" vouchers, 4 x £10 restaurant vouchers, and e.g. 2 x £100 and 1 x £40 Goldsmiths vouchers, all of which could be used on each other iyswim.
